The construction of DEGAS (DEGenerate Advanced Source), a proof of principle for a quantum limited brightness electron source, has been completed at the Lawrence Berkeley National Laboratory. The commissioning and the characterization of this source, designed to generate coherent low energy (10-100 eV) single electron "bunches" with brightness approaching the quantum limit at a repetition rate of few MHz, has been started. In this paper the first experimental results are described.
